What is a remote technical analyst?

A Remote Technical Analyst is a professional who analyzes technical systems, processes, and data for an organization while working from a remote location. Their responsibilities often include troubleshooting technical issues, monitoring system performance, recommending improvements, and providing technical support to clients or team members. They use various software tools to assess and resolve problems, communicate findings, and ensure efficient system operations. Working remotely allows them to collaborate with teams and clients across different locations using digital communication platforms.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ote technical analyst?

To thrive as a Remote Technical Analyst, strong analytical skills, a background in IT or computer science, and experience with troubleshooting complex technical issues are essential. Familiarity with ticketing systems, remote support tools, and certifications like CompTIA A+ or ITIL can be highly beneficial.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and self-motivation help distinguish top performers in remote settings. These skills and qualities are crucial for efficiently resolving technical problems, maintaining productivity, and ensuring seamless support despite physical distance.

How does a remote technical analyst typically collaborate with cross-functional teams while working offsite?

As a Remote Technical Analyst, collaboration with cross-functional teams is primarily managed through digital communication tools such as Slack, Microsoft Teams, and project management platforms. Regular virtual meetings, clear documentation, and proactive status updates are essential for staying aligned with developers, product managers, and business stakeholders. Building strong communication habits and being responsive to queries helps ensure that technical solutions meet the needs of all departments, despite the physical distance. Cultivating relationships remotely can be a challenge at first, but leveraging video calls and participating in team discussions can foster a sense of connection and shared purpose.

What is the difference between Remote Technical Analyst vs Remote Technical Support Specialist?

AspectRemote Technical AnalystRemote Technical Support Specialist
Required CredentialsTypically requires a degree in IT, Computer Science, or related field; certifications like CompTIA A+ or Network+ are commonOften requires similar certifications; a degree is preferred but not always mandatory
Work EnvironmentAnalyzes technical issues, assesses systems, and provides strategic solutions, often working with internal teams or clientsProvides technical assistance, troubleshooting, and support directly to end-users or customers
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in IT departments, consulting firms, and tech companies for system analysis and optimizationCommon in customer service centers, tech support companies, and IT service providers

While both roles involve technical knowledge and troubleshooting, Remote Technical Analysts focus on analyzing systems and providing strategic solutions, whereas Remote Technical Support Specialists primarily assist end-users with technical issues. Both roles require similar certifications and often operate in remote environments, but their core responsibilities differ in scope and focus.
